Background on Septic Systems
Septic systems consist of a tank and a drain field. The tank collects wastewater and allows solids to settle at the bottom, where bacteria break them down. This process is essential for preventing clogs and ensuring the system operates efficiently. However, the balance of good bacteria can be disrupted by various factors, including the use of harsh chemicals, excessive water usage, and improper disposal of non-biodegradable items.

Effective Strategies for Maintaining Good Bacteria in Your Septic System
How to Maintain Good Bacteria in Your Septic System
Maintaining good bacteria in your septic system is essential for its proper functioning. Here are several strategies that can help ensure a healthy bacterial balance, tailored to various situations and conditions.
1. Regular Pumping
One of the most effective ways to maintain good bacteria is through regular pumping of your septic tank. This prevents the buildup of solids that can hinder bacterial activity.
- Frequency: Typically, tanks should be pumped every 3 to 5 years, but this can vary based on usage and tank size.
- State Regulations: Some states have specific guidelines for pumping frequency, so check local regulations.
2. Use of Bacterial Additives
Many homeowners consider using bacterial additives to boost the population of good bacteria in their septic systems.
- Types: There are various products available, including liquid and dry formulations. Look for those that contain live bacteria strains.
- Caution: Avoid products that contain harsh chemicals, as they can kill beneficial bacteria.
3. Proper Waste Disposal
What you put down the drain significantly impacts the health of your septic system.
- Biodegradable Products: Use biodegradable soaps, detergents, and toilet paper to support bacterial growth.
- Avoid: Do not flush non-biodegradable items, grease, or chemicals that can disrupt bacterial activity.
4. Water Usage Management
Excessive water usage can overwhelm your septic system and disrupt the balance of good bacteria.
- Conserve Water: Implement water-saving practices, such as fixing leaks and using water-efficient appliances.
- Distribution: Spread out water usage throughout the day to prevent overloading the system at once.
5. Soil and Drain Field Maintenance
The drain field is crucial for the final treatment of wastewater, and its health directly affects bacterial activity.
- Vegetation: Maintain grass cover over the drain field to help absorb excess water.
- Avoid Compaction: Do not park vehicles or place heavy objects on the drain field, as this can compact the soil and hinder drainage.

1. Regular Maintenance
Regular maintenance is the backbone of a healthy septic system.
- Pumping Schedule: Schedule pumping every 3 to 5 years, depending on the size of your tank and the number of people in your household. For example, a family of four may need to pump more frequently than a single-person household.
- Cost: Pumping typically costs between $200 and $500, depending on your location and the size of your tank.
2. Use Water Wisely
Water management is crucial for maintaining good bacteria.
- Spread Out Usage: Instead of running all your appliances at once, spread out laundry and dishwashing throughout the week. This prevents overwhelming the system.
- Install Water-Saving Devices: Low-flow toilets and faucet aerators can significantly reduce water usage, helping maintain the balance in your septic system.
3. Choose the Right Cleaning Products
The cleaning products you use can either support or harm the good bacteria in your septic system.
- Biodegradable Options: Opt for biodegradable soaps and detergents. For instance, brands like Seventh Generation or Ecover offer eco-friendly cleaning solutions that are less harmful to your septic system.
- Avoid Antibacterial Products: Many common household cleaners contain antibacterial agents that can kill beneficial bacteria. Avoid using these products in your home.
4. Be Mindful of What Goes Down the Drain
What you flush or pour down the drain can have a significant impact on your septic system.
- Flushing Guidelines: Only flush toilet paper and human waste. Avoid flushing items like wipes, feminine hygiene products, or dental floss, which can clog the system.
- Grease Disposal: Never pour grease down the drain. Instead, collect it in a container and dispose of it in the trash. Grease can solidify in the tank and disrupt bacterial activity.
5. Know Your System
Understanding the type of septic system you have can help you take better care of it.
- Conventional vs. Alternative Systems: Conventional systems rely on gravity, while alternative systems may use pumps or aerators. Each type has specific maintenance needs.
- Local Regulations: Some states have specific regulations regarding septic systems. Familiarize yourself with these to ensure compliance.
6. Avoid Overloading the System
Overloading your septic system can lead to failures and costly repairs.
- Limit Heavy Loads: If you have a large family, consider doing laundry in smaller loads rather than one large load. This can help prevent overwhelming the system.
- Seasonal Adjustments: During rainy seasons, be cautious about water usage, as saturated soil can hinder drainage.
7. Common Mistakes to Avoid
Being aware of common mistakes can save you time and money.
- Ignoring Signs of Trouble: Don’t ignore signs like slow drains or foul odors. These can indicate a problem that needs immediate attention.
- Neglecting the Drain Field: Avoid parking vehicles or placing heavy objects on the drain field, as this can compact the soil and disrupt drainage.
- DIY Repairs: Avoid attempting DIY repairs unless you are knowledgeable about septic systems. Improper repairs can lead to more significant issues.

9. Cost Considerations
While maintaining a septic system can incur costs, it is often less expensive than dealing with failures.
- Annual Maintenance Costs: Expect to spend about $300 to $700 annually on maintenance, including pumping, inspections, and minor repairs.
- Repair Costs: If your system fails, repairs can range from $3,000 to $10,000, depending on the severity of the issue and the type of system.

1. Frequency of Pumping
According to the Environmental Protection Agency (EPA), septic tanks should be pumped every 3 to 5 years. However, the frequency can vary based on several factors:
- Household size: Larger families may need more frequent pumping.
- Tank size: Smaller tanks fill up more quickly.
- Water usage: High water usage can lead to faster accumulation of solids.
2. Impact of Cleaning Products
A study by the University of Minnesota found that household cleaning products can significantly affect the bacterial balance in septic systems.
- Products containing bleach and antibacterial agents can kill beneficial bacteria.
- Using eco-friendly and biodegradable products can help maintain a healthy bacterial population.
